Why Extra Long Downspout Splash Block Is Necessary

From my experience, having an extra long downspout splash block is a game-changer for protecting my home’s foundation. When rainwater pours off the roof, it can easily pool right next to the foundation, causing erosion and even basement leaks over time. The longer splash block helps channel that water further away, preventing damage before it starts.

I’ve also noticed that a standard splash block sometimes isn’t enough during heavy storms. The extra length gives me peace of mind by directing large volumes of water safely away from my yard and walkways, reducing muddy spots and soil washouts. It’s a simple upgrade that saves me from costly repairs and keeps my landscaping intact.

Why Choose an Extra Long Downspout Splash Block?

I wanted to ensure that water from my roof didn’t pool near my foundation, which can cause costly damage over time. The extra length means water travels further away from the foundation, reducing erosion and basement leaks. It also helps when you have heavy rainfall or a steep roof that channels a lot of water through your downspouts.

Material Matters: What Works Best?

I found that splash blocks come in a variety of materials like concrete, plastic, and rubber. Concrete ones are very durable but heavy and can crack over time. Plastic splash blocks are lightweight and affordable, but some cheaper models can warp or fade under the sun. Rubber splash blocks offer flexibility and longevity, which was a big plus for me given the climate variations in my area.

Size and Length Considerations

Since I needed an extra long model, I looked for splash blocks that extended at least 24 inches or more. This length ensures water disperses well away from the home. However, it’s also important to measure your downspout outlet height and the slope of your yard to pick the right size that fits perfectly without causing water to splash back.

Ease of Installation

I prefer products that don’t require complicated installation. Most splash blocks just slide under the downspout and stay in place by gravity. Some extra long models come with stakes or connectors to secure them better, which is helpful if you live in a windy area or have pets.

Maintenance and Durability

I wanted something low maintenance. The best splash blocks are easy to clean—usually just a rinse with a garden hose to remove debris. Durable materials like rubber or heavy-duty plastic resist cracking, fading, and weather damage, so they last for years without needing replacement.

Cost and Value

While it’s tempting to go for the cheapest option, I found investing a bit more in a high-quality extra long splash block pays off in the long run. Cheaper models may degrade quickly, leading to more expenses down the road. I balanced cost with durability and length to get the best value.

Additional Features to Look For

Some splash blocks come with built-in channels or ridges that help guide the water flow more effectively. Others have textured surfaces to prevent slipping if you step on them accidentally. If aesthetics matter to you, there are splash blocks designed to blend in with your landscaping or painted to match your home exterior.
